Ingredients
  

2 cups cooked chicken breast, shredded

2 cups mixed salad greens (romaine, spinach, arugula)

1 cup shredded red cabbage

1 cup shredded carrots

1/2 cup chopped fresh cilantro

1/2 cup chopped green onions

1/2 cup thinly sliced bell peppers (red and yellow)

1/2 cup chopped roasted peanuts (for garnish)

For the Dressing:

1/4 cup fish sauce (or soy sauce for a vegetarian option)

1/4 cup fresh lime juice

2 tablespoons honey or agave syrup

1 tablespoon sesame oil

1 clove garlic, minced

1 teaspoon grated ginger

1 teaspoon Sriracha (optional, for heat)

Instructions
 

Prepare the Chicken: If not using pre-cooked chicken, grill or boil the chicken breasts until fully cooked. Let them cool, then shred with two forks.

    Make the Dressing: In a small bowl, whisk together the fish sauce, lime juice, honey, sesame oil, garlic, ginger, and Sriracha until well blended.

      Combine Salad Ingredients: In a large mixing bowl, combine the shredded chicken, mixed greens, red cabbage, carrots, cilantro, green onions, and bell peppers. Toss gently to combine.

        Dress the Salad: Drizzle the dressing over the salad mixture. Toss gently until the dressings coats the ingredients evenly.

          Serve: Transfer the salad to a serving platter or individual plates. Top with chopped roasted peanuts for an added crunch.

            Enjoy: Serve immediately and enjoy the vibrant flavors of this Thai Chicken Salad!

              Prep Time: 20 minutes | Total Time: 30 minutes | Servings: 4
